Best time and place to align Rifles?
-
With 4.33 and the need to align the Maverics with the TGPs, where is the best place to do so?
I have tried on the ground during ramping (ground jett enabled etc) but cant seem to (a) find anything to lock the TGP onto, or (b) if I do the Maverick pointers dont depress enough to boresight.
In the air is troublesome trying find a viable target.
What is your experience with this issue my brothers.
-
Hi Mower.
You can put in your flight plan a STPT, after TOC and before holding point, where your flight can point an objetct and align your Mavs. It should be a place where you can find a “pointable” object. You should prepare this point when creating the mission and then you should brief this issue.
On the ground is very difficult to do. An ideal place will be on EOR and arm/dearm platform.
-
What Ender said. I usually plan to overfly a friendly city, with the FP-leg leading to it giving me some 10-20nm to do the procedure. Buildings are great for BSGT, but verify that you’re locked on the same part of the building or you might get into problems. If I forget to plan for it, I’ll SnowPlow for GM returns and find something 20 miles out, and allign with that. Make sure that thing isn’t a SAM, though

The problem is that the farther away your alignment target is, the better your alignment will be…harder to solve on deck, but workable. You have to find a suitable location and target, though. Preferably a stationary one.
-
Practice makes perfect, you’ll soon be able to boresight your Mavs in a minute, or less when you get really proficient.
I do the same as Ender and set Steerpoint 2 or 3 on a town/factory/powerplant just after taking off to use a building for point-tracking and boresighting, before switching the Mavs off (so they don’t time out later when you really need them) and climbing up to altitude.
That way the boresighting procedure really doesn’t get in the way much at all, no more than ops checks or any other basic system checks enroute.
